Matthew 5:10-12

Blessed are the persecuted for righteousness, for theirs is the kingdom of heaven.

Matthew 21:35

And the husbandmen took his servants, and beat one, and killed another, and stoned another.

Matthew 23:34-37

Therefore, behold, I send you prophets, and wise men, and scribes. Some of them you will kill and crucify; and some of them you will scourge in your synagogues, and persecute from city to city;

Acts 4:3

and they laid hands on them and put them in prison till the next day; for it was now evening.

Acts 5:18

and laid hands on the apostles, and put them in the public prison.

Acts 5:40

And they were persuaded by him, and calling the apostles and scourging them, they charged them not to speak in the name of Jesus, and dismissed them.

Acts 7:52

Which of the prophets did not your fathers persecute? And they killed those who foretold the coming of the Righteous One, of whom you now have become betrayers and murderers,

Acts 16:22-24

And the multitude came together against them, and the prefects tearing off their clothes gave orders to beat them with rods,

Hebrews 11:36-37

and others had trial of mockings and scourges, and besides of bonds and imprisonment;

Revelation 2:10

Fear not what you are about to suffer. Behold, the devil is about to cast some of you into prison, that you may be tried, and you shall have affliction ten days. Be faithful till death, and I will give you the crown of life.

Revelation 17:6

And I saw the woman drunk with the blood of the saints and the blood of the martyrs of Jesus, and I wondered when I saw her with great wonder.
